A guideline for factors considered:
Outstanding main feature: very rarely or never seen before features, visually outstanding features, or an incredibly useful feature or set of features
Supporting features: additional features that make the seed an experience beyond a single location
Usability in survival: features should generally be close to spawn and have some use to the player
Presentation: Well presented seeds, such as the use of artistic screenshots, shaders and mapping tools
Personality: Seeds with character and engaging narratives that spark your imagination of the world
We also showcase other great seeds and posts that have slightly different conditions, such as legacy, modded or large biome versions. Find them in the Spotlights section.

I'm sorry for posting this 6 years later, the seed is 460367020 or you can type "village" in the seed column, and don't forget to set the world type to Single biome > Plains. The village is placed near spawn, and the ravine's deepest point goes down to Y: 10. Additionally, the village's well is also connected with the bottom part, which is quite rare in today's Minecraft, because commonly (whether it's a bug or not) the plains village's well bottom part is separated from the top one. Sadly, the ravine has no exposed diamond ores, and the most important, this is before 1.18, but at least, it has... (see the last slide)

While I was sketching out a mountain range, I checked the seed finder and stumbled upon this frozen gem. It’s a seed dominated by frozen biomes—snowy taiga, groves, and snowy plains or slopes—centered around a snowy mountain formation where most peaks reach Y=255. What makes it special is that these mountains are surrounded by a stretch of ice spikes, a frozen spring, and a frozen ocean!
